Course Description

This course is designed for adults and older teens who want to build confidence and competence outdoors. Participants will learn essential outdoor skills including the fundamentals of outdoor recreation, safety, and self-reliance. Participants will learn essential skills for enjoying the outdoors safely and confidently, including outdoor/emergency preparedness, navigation, wildlife identification, camping basics, fishing fundamentals, hunting fundamentals, conservation principles, and outdoor ethics. Through practical demonstrations and hands-on activities, participants will gain the knowledge needed to begin exploring Michigan's outdoor opportunities.
